Role: Functional Skills Maths Tutor

Location: Peterborough Fengate

Hours: Monday–Friday, 8:30am–5:00pm (37.5 hours per week)

Contract: Permanent

Reporting to: Centre Manager

Salary: £25k–£27k unqualified, £28k–£30k qualified

About Our Client

Our client, part of the TCHC Group, is an organisation committed to creating opportunities for all. Since 2004, they have supported young people and adults to learn, achieve, and progress. They are ethical, supportive, disability-confident, and focused on teamwork and positive outcomes for every learner.

Who We Are Seeking

Our client is looking for an experienced educator with a strong commitment to supporting learners with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ND). The role is based at Thurrock GAPS, where learners present a range of complex needs including global developmental delay, dyslexia, autism, ADHD, Down syndrome, and social communication challenges. Learners progress at a slower pace and require additional support with communication and emotional regulation.

The position is for a Functional Skills Maths Tutor, delivering Entry Level 1–3 and Level 1–2 Maths to small groups of up to 12 high-needs learners. This is not a mainstream teaching environment and requires someone patient, adaptable, and confident in managing diverse needs.

What Our Client Needs

A responsible and professional tutor who can plan, deliver, and differentiate the Functional Skills maths curriculum effectively, including:

  • Functional Skills Maths Entry Level 1–2
  • Functional Skills Maths Level 1–2

Delivery should be creative, engaging, and aligned with learner goals. A dedicated Quality Assurance Team will support continuous improvement and KPI achievement.

Essential Qualifications & Experience

  • AET/CERT ED/PGCE or equivalent
  • Maths GCSE Grade C/4 or Functional Skills Level 2
  • Assessor qualification
  • Experience teaching learners with varied abilities and learning differences

Desirable

  • SEN qualifications
  • Experience working with EHCPs

Key Responsibilities

  • Plan and deliver schemes of work tailored to individual needs
  • Create innovative lesson plans and practical group activities
  • Use resources that effectively support high-needs learners
  • Carry out diagnostic assessments and monitor progress
  • Provide clear objectives, feedback, and exam preparation
  • Maintain accurate records and administrative documentation
  • Work with the Quality Assurance team to sustain high delivery standards
  • Maintain up-to-date CPD
  • Adhere to Safeguarding, Prevent, and GDPR requirements
  • Travel to other sites where required
